Saint Francis Emergency Department and Trauma Care

Saint Francis describes its Emergency and Trauma Center as the only state-designated Level III Emergency and Trauma Center in southeast Missouri. The Emergency Department is listed as open 24/7/365 and is for life- or limb-threatening medical conditions, severe abdominal pain, symptoms of heart attack or stroke, trauma, and other serious emergencies.

Urgent Care or Emergency Room: How to Choose

Saint Francis urgent care pages describe walk-in care for non-life-threatening illness and injury. Use urgent care or a provider route for stable problems, and use the ER for severe or dangerous symptoms.

Urgent care may fit

  • Cold or flu symptoms.
  • Sore or strep throat.
  • Minor sprains, strains, cuts, bruises, or rashes.
  • Ear or eye infections.
  • Minor burns or insect bites.
  • Stable non-emergency symptoms that are not rapidly worsening.

ER is safer for

  • Chest pain, stroke signs, or severe shortness of breath.
  • Major injury, severe wounds, head injury, or motor vehicle accident.
  • Seizure, loss of consciousness, severe abdominal pain, or serious trauma.
  • Symptoms that could worsen during driving.

Saint Francis Medical Records: MyChart First, Formal Request When Needed

Saint Francis Health Information Management, also called the Medical Record Department, fulfills record requests. Patients may also view portions of their records online through Saint Francis MyChart at no cost.

🔐

Use MyChart first

Use MyChart for available digital records, test results, visit information, medication information, and selected portal documents.

📄

Use formal records request for copies

For formal copies, legal release, older records, or third-party records, call Medical Records at 573-331-5120.

Medical Records phone573-331-5120.
In-person supportSaint Francis lists Medical Records Department support Monday–Friday, 7 am–4:30 pm.
ID and authorizationA government-issued photo ID and valid authorization may be required. Legal representative paperwork may be required for someone else’s records.
Processing timeSaint Francis lists typical processing time as seven to ten business days, depending on record availability.
Continuity of careRecords released directly to a provider or licensed healthcare facility for continuity of care may have no charge.

Billing, Financial Assistance, Estimates and Insurance Questions

Saint Francis billing information explains that the Medical Center bill includes hospital services, while some physician specialists may bill separately for professional services. That means one hospital visit can create more than one bill.

🧾

Billing questions

Call 573-331-5217 or 866-304-3071. Have the account number, patient name, date of service, insurance card, and bill copy ready.

💳

Cost estimates

Use the online MyChart patient estimate tool or call 573-331-5217 option #2 to speak with a financial counselor.

🤝

Financial assistance

Saint Francis lists phone help Monday–Friday, 8 am–5:30 pm. Traditional financial assistance may require tax returns and total household earnings.

Billing reality: Do not assume a second bill is a duplicate. Match the date of service, provider, account number, company name, and payment address before paying.
